Transaction 05faf91283af486b39e079fef4e61fbac077cfa375eb53619585bf353ff2bd88

1 Input
1 Outputs
  • 05faf91283af486b39e079fef4e61fbac077cfa375eb53619585bf353ff2bd88:0
  • value  706320
    address  16WMicVZ442997Ea3cq6ciYZgpsonZefLu